WebAug 14, 2024 · I am trying to render a raymarched scene in a GLSL fragment shader. I am able to draw the scene successfully when not using a MVP matrix and just marching a ray … WebMay 22, 2024 · After rasterizing these, each pixel passed to the fragment shader represents a single ray. The fragment shader marches that ray until it reaches the surface, returning …
Creating a Shadow Caster Pass for a Ray Marching Shader
WebAlternative build systems. Minimal example without bgfx’s example harness. Examples. 00-helloworld. 01-cubes. 02-metaballs. 03-raymarch. 04-mesh. 05-instancing. WebAdd depth to your project with Raymarcher asset from Matej Vanco. Find this & more VFX options on the Unity Asset Store. highlight weekends and holidays in excel
Ray Marching for Dummies! - YouTube
WebJul 1, 2016 · This tutorial explains how to create complex 3D shapes inside volumetric shaders. Signed Distance Functions (often referred as Fields) are mathematical tools … WebRyan Brucks has some nice write up here where he describes some workarounds. I'm specifically trying to understand the plane alignment technique: //bring vectors into local space to support object transforms float3 localcampos = mul (float4 ( ResolvedView.WorldCameraOrigin,1.00000000), (Primitive.WorldToLocal)).xyz; float3 … WebOct 1, 2016 · Writing the Raymarch Function. Now that we have built a distance field to sample, we can write the core raymarch loop. This loop will be called from the fragment … small people and you and you